Property Description for 23 West 73rd Street, PH-2

Duplex Penthouse with 3 Terraces, Park Views, and Home Office on a Park Block!

Welcome to this exceptional 1-bedroom + home office duplex, where luxury meets unique charm. This remarkable residence features three expansive terraces, each accessible from different living spaces, providing an unparalleled indoor-outdoor living experience.

Upon entering, you are greeted by south-facing windows and doors that flood the newly renovated kitchen and open living area with natural light. The main living level also includes a half bath and coat closet for storage. Floor-to-ceiling glass doors open to the first terrace, perfect for entertaining guests or enjoying a quiet moment of relaxation while taking in the stunning views. Not to mention, an incredible vantage point for viewing the Macy's Thanksgiving Day Parade!

The spiral staircase leads to the second level where you will find the south-facing king-sized bedroom, home office and a windowed full bath with a tub/shower. The bedroom boasts custom built-in wall storage and a walk-in closet along with the second terrace, offering stunning aerial views of Central Park, the Dakota, and the Manhattan skyline.

The home office is privately tucked away and opens onto the third and final huge terrace. The north-facing views over the Upper West Side rooftops are highlighted by the iconic San Remo and glimpses of Central Park.

Modern amenities include central A/C and a private penthouse-floor laundry room with complimentary washer/dryers.
Electricity, heat, and hot water are included in the rent, with seasonal fees for central air usage.

The Park Royal is a full-service white glove building that lives up to its stellar reputation. The incredible staff includes doormen, concierges, a live-in super, an assistant super, and several porters. Originally a luxury hotel, the Park Royal offers classic New York luxury at its finest.

Building amenities include a large laundry room, bicycle room, package room, and private access to the NYSC Sports Club located within the building. The building is very pet-friendly!

Please note that Co-op Board Approval and an interview are required. No short-term rentals are allowed. This is a shareholder unit, and board approval is necessary.

Upper West Side | Manhattan

Quick Profile

Bracketed on its east and west borders by massive city parks, the Upper West Side (UWS) is known for its greenery, stately and elegant townhomes, safe streets and great schools, all of which make it a very desirable neighborhood for families. The UWS has maintained its community feeling, making it attractive to young professionals and retirees, both of whom want a sense of belonging in the place they call home.

Here you’ll find many apartment buildings, especially those along Central Park West. Historic architecture abounds, anchored by four luxury co-ops - the San Remo, Majestic, Century and Eldorado apartments - all of which have two towers on their interiors. They were built in the 1930s and their design was predicated on a 1929 building code that imposed a height limit on residences facing the street. There are also impressive row houses near Riverside Drive throughout the W 70 and 80 Streets. Above the 90s, you will find smaller buildings where walk-ups are very reasonably priced.

There are several world-class museums and venues dedicated to the performing arts. Plentiful dining can be found in the UWS. You will find everything from quaint Jewish delis serving up bagels and a schmear to sophisticated fine dining that has earned multiple Michelin stars, and everything you could possibly want in between. There is also abundant shopping and a vibrant nightlife.
